Näringsretention i återskapad våtmark på betesmark : studier av en mad vid Bornsjön
It is important to construct or recreate different types of wetlands and study their retention of nutrients, since knowledge of their effectiveness in this matter is poor. In 2003 a wetland was constructed on an old meadow on the western shore of Lake Bornsjön in central Sweden. The main purpose of the wetland was to reduce the amount of phosphorus entering the lake, which is the back-up water supply for Stockholm when the city cannot obtain water from Lake Mälaren. Large areas around Lake Bornsjön consist of agricultural land and the nutrient concentrations in the inflows to the lake are usually relatively high (approx. 1 mg/l total nitrogen and 0.05-0.1 mg/l total phosphorus).

Framtidens Hus
The company Sol & Energiteknik wanted to examine the possibility to make a standardhouse totally energy independent. Based upon this I have, during the spring of 2007,examined the possibilities available at the market today through litterature studies, contactwith several companies and reading reports at the internet.The first thing to examine has been to determine the energy consumption for a standardhouse, and find out if there are better technologies to be used for energy conservation.My conclusion in this matter is that there are possibilities today for building a house moreenergy efficient.When I had reached the point at which my design for the house was decided, I also hadto choose the different products to use to produce energy as well as to store that energy.To produce heat and electricity to the house I decided to use a wind turbine and a solarwater heater.The most difficult part of designing a house that is energy independent is that theproduced energy must be stored somehow. Storing the heat is relatively easy beacuse theheat can be stored in a large water tank. The electricity is a bigger problem beacuse itmust be stored in batteries, which today are too expensive to be used in a standard house.In the future producing and storing hydrogen might be used to produce electricity, buttoday that technology is both expensive and not tested enough.My final conclusion is that a standard house can not be built to be totally energyindependent today, unless it is very expensive to connect the house to the electricitynetwork. As an alternative solution I came up with a proposal for a house which isconnected to the electricity network and have some amount of own produced energy.This house prooved to be a good investment if you choose to build it today, and it couldbe a very good investment in the long run beacuse energy prices increase every year..

Nitrat i dricksvatten : jämförelse av nitrathalter, mellan åren 1975 och 2005
Ronneby Miljö- och hälsoskyddskontor ville genom undersökningen få information om nitrathalter ienskilda dricksvattenbrunnar inom kommunen, med bakgrund av den nya miljökvalitetsnormen.Riktvärdet för nitrat är 50 mg/l. Halter som överstiger detta bör inte ges till barn under ett års ålder pågrund av risk för methemoglobinemi. Jämförelsen skulle ske mellan områden präglade av jordbrukrespektive skogsbruk, samt mellan grävda och borrade brunnar. Jämförelsen skulle även ske över tiden,mellan 1975-1990 till 2005. Urvalet av provtagningspunkter baserades på en sammanställning frånbefintligt arkiv samt efter en annons i dagspressen.

GIS och statistik vid dräneringsområdesvis kväveläckagebeskrivning i Halland
The last decades have shown increased nitrogen leeching from soil to water recipients. This is inSweden mainly due to over-manuring of agriculture land, effectivization of drainage systems and thedeclining extent of wetlands. The accumulated amount of nitrogen in water doesn?t only make itunsuitable for use by humans and cattle, but also decreases the biological diversity as well as negativelyaffect tourism and fish industry. In the most severe cases shallow maritime grounds can be completelydepleted of oxygen due to decomposition of the increased amount algae and plankton growth.This study have the aim to describe and quantify the nitrogen leeching from the Genevad drainagebasin, located in southern Halland, Sweden.

Inventering av värmelager för kraftvärmesystem
When a combined heat and power plant produces heat and power it often faces a deficit of heat load during the summer or other periods of time. This heat is often unnecessarily cooled away or the power production has to be reduced or shut off. If it is possible to store heat from periods with low heat demand to periods with high heat demand one can get many benefits. Among these benefits are: increased power production, decreased operation with partial load, uniformly distributed load.To be able to store heat in situations like this long-term thermal heat storages are needed. In this thesis five different types of stores are presented: rock cavern storage, tank storage, pit water storage, borehole storage and aquifer storage.
Utvärdering av lockmedel för marklevande predatorer under midvintermånader i Norrbottens inland
Many invasive species propose a big threat against the native fauna in the area that they colonise. Today the raccoon dog (Nyctereutes procyonoides) is speeding from Finland over the border in to northern Sweden. A project to stop the spread and eliminate the individuals that already have established was initiated in the autumn of 2008. To investigate areas that might be interesting for raccoon dogs and to confirm sightings, cameras with auto triggering mechanisms are used. To get the raccoon dog in front of the camera some kind of lure is used.
In this study three kinds of different lures was tested against each other?s.
Käppalaverkets nuvarande och framtida rötningskapacitet : en studie i labskala
Käppala wastewater treatment plant situated on the island of Lidingö northeast of Stockholm is running a project during 2004 and 2005 with the purpose to map out the capacity of anaerobic digestion in the digesters that treat primary and excess sludge. The purpose of this thesis work, which is part of that project, was to characterize the present anaerobic digestion process and to investigate its capacity to treat other organic wastes such as restaurant waste and waste from water works. To decide the potential of both methane and biogas production from different substrates batch laboratory tests were carried out. To imitate the anaerobic digestion process at Käppala continuous tests with small scale reactors were carried out. These reactors were later fed with restaurant waste.The batch laboratory tests showed that primary sludge had a potential biogas and methane production of 0,62 and 0,35 Ndm3/g VS respectively after 40 days of digestion.
